U18: Bryson previews Rovers trip

Sunderland under-18s are on the road once again today as they travel to Blackburn Rovers for a 12:30pm kick-off.

The young Black Cats endured a challenging afternoon on Saturday as they were downed 6-0 at highflying Everton.

However, today provides the youth team with the chance to issue a response against a Blackburn Rovers side, who only just edged past them at the Academy of Light 3-2 earlier this season.

Rovers head into today’s fixture on a good run of form, though, having taken 10 points from a possible 15 to consolidate their place in eighth in the Premier League table.

Speaking to safc.com ahead of today’s trip to Lancashire, under-18s boss Paul Bryson had this to say… 

“It’s good for us to have this match coming around so quickly because of what happened on Saturday. 

“We picked up some more injuries so it’s going to be a challenge once again, but I’ve spoken to the lads and they know Tuesday is a chance for a response.

“Saturday was a tough result to take, we’re stretched in terms of numbers and we’re having to play a lot of young players.

“The beauty of football, though, is you’ve got a chance to put it right in your next game so again, Tuesday is a chance for one or two of the younger ones to stand up, push their chests out and show what they can do.

“It’s tough but they will benefit from it next year when they are playing in this age bracket on a more weekly basis.”
